Alessandro Volta, the renowned Italian physicist, is celebrated for his groundbreaking invention of the electric battery and the electrophorus. Prior to Volta's achievements, researchers like Benjamin Franklin could only experiment with static electricity. Volta’s creation of the voltaic pile in 1800 provided a continuous source of electric current, sparking a revolution in scientific discovery. His work laid the foundation for modern electrical devices, inspiring inventions like Joseph Henry’s electromagnets and Samuel Morse’s telegraph. This 1805 example, on display at the National Museum of American History, showcases Volta’s genius and his pivotal role in advancing the understanding of electricity.
